Required forms and documents

To import telecommunications satellite dishes into the USA, importers need to complete several forms and provide necessary documents. A bill of lading, issued by the shipping carrier, serves as a contract between the exporter and importer and includes details of the shipment. A commercial invoice provides information on the value of the goods, their origin, and other relevant details. The import declaration, also known as Customs Form 3461, is used to declare the imported goods to the CBP. In addition, importers may need to provide various certificates and permits, depending on the nature of the goods and any regulatory requirements.

Preparing Customs Documents

Filing Importer Security Filing (ISF)

Before the arrival of the filing cabinets in the USA, it is necessary to file an Importer Security Filing (ISF) with U.S. Customs and Border Protection. The ISF provides information about the cargo, including the shipper, consignee, and details about the filing cabinets. This information allows the CBP to assess potential security risks and facilitate customs clearance. Ensure you have the necessary information from your supplier to complete the ISF accurately and submit it within the specified time frame, usually 24 hours before the vessel departure. Filing the ISF in a timely and accurate manner helps prevent customs delays and penalties.

Calculating import duties and taxes

Importing goods into the USA entails paying import duties and taxes, which can significantly affect your overall cost. To accurately calculate these charges, you need to determine the Harmonized System (HS) code for office desk cable sleeves. The HS code is an internationally recognized classification system that assigns a unique code to each product. By knowing the HS code, you can refer to the U.S. International Trade Commission’s Harmonized Tariff Schedule to find the applicable duty rates. Additionally, consider the calculation of any sales taxes or value-added taxes (VAT) that may be applicable at the state or local levels.

Understanding Trade Agreements

Understanding trade agreements is vital for importers of kitchen electric juicers. Exploring the Generalized System of Preferences (GSP) allows you to identify any preferential trade arrangements that may benefit your imports. GSP provides reduced or zero tariffs for eligible products imported from designated beneficiary countries.

Considering Free Trade Agreements (FTA) is highly recommended to leverage tariff reductions. Familiarize yourself with the terms and conditions of any FTAs that the USA has with other countries. Determine if the kitchen electric juicers you import may be eligible for preferential tariff treatment under such agreements.

Utilizing special trade programs or benefits can further optimize your import operations. Research programs such as duty drawback, temporary importation under bond, or foreign-trade zones, among others. These programs offer specific benefits that can help reduce costs and streamline the import process for kitchen electric juicers.

Navigating import quotas and tariff-rate quotas is crucial for certain products. Determine if kitchen electric juicers are subject to any import quotas or tariff-rate quotas. Compliance with these quota restrictions is essential to avoid penalties or surcharges on your imports.
